Sea lions — and their stench — rule La Jolla’s coastline


Sea lions — and their stench — rule La Jolla’s coastlineA battle is underway in La Jolla, after sea lions conquered the town’s beaches, claiming them as their own breeding grounds. The sea lions are constantly pooping, and the smell can drift blocks away. Visitors view sea lions at the La Jolla Cove this month. With their increasing numbers, sea lions are running out of space at their longtime home in the uninhabited Channel Islands, where most sea lions breed.
